The Breakdown 5

  • A royal ceremony at Windsor Castle celebrated remarkable individuals, with Adjoa Andoh, star of Bridgerton, receiving an MBE from Prince William, expressing her heartfelt humility during the event.
  • The event showcased emotional moments, particularly Andoh’s touching interaction with the Prince, capturing the spirit of honor and recognition.
  • King Charles III, also present at the ceremony, awarded an MBE to 18-time Grand Slam champion Andy Lapthorne, demonstrating his dedication to celebrating British achievement.
  • TV presenter Claudia Winkleman received her MBE from King Charles as well, radiating joy in a chic white suit, highlighting the glamour of the occasion.
  • Darts champion Luke Humphries reflected on his personal experience with Prince William while receiving his MBE, sharing insights into the significance of such an honor.

What is the significance of an MBE?

The Member of the Order of the British Empire (MBE) is a prestigious honor awarded by the British monarchy. It recognizes individuals for significant contributions to their communities or fields, such as arts, sciences, and charitable work. Receiving an MBE is a mark of distinction and public recognition, often boosting the recipient's profile and influence.

What is the history of the MBE award?

The MBE was established in 1917 by King George V as part of the Order of the British Empire. It was created to honor individuals for their service during World War I. Over the years, the award has evolved to recognize contributions across various fields, reflecting societal changes and values.
